AFC Bournemouth vs. Chelsea Preview

AFC Bournemouth vs Chelsea: Preview, Team News and Predictions

   Chelsea will have to return to winning ways if they’re to avoid any scares of last season, when they travel to the Vitality stadium to take on Afc Bournemouth on Sunday, September 17th.

   The Blues have salvaged just one win – against bottom-dwellers Luton Town in their opening four fixtures. And although they seem to be going in the wrong direction, Mauricio Pochettino has masterminded game flow control in all the matches they’ve featured in so far, including a showdown against Liverpool. 

   They recorded a rare double against Bournemouth last season, having won just one of their previous five against the Cherries.

   The hosts, meanwhile, are winless in their last eight league matches. But defeats to Tottenham Hotspur and Liverpool, and hard-earned draws against formidable opponents in West Ham and Brentford might not entirely paint the picture.

Team News

AFC Bournemouth

   Deadline day signing Luis Sinisterra is available to make his debut to Bournemouth, with the team otherwise muddled with injuries.

   The medical bay includes Alex Scott, Ryan Fredericks, and Emiliano Marcondes. Dango Ouattara has shaken off an ankle strain and is in contention to suit up.

Chelsea

   The Blues have witnessed over 55 injuries since the start of last season. Romeo Lavia suffered a fresh ankle setback and is set to remain sidelined alongside summer signing Christopher Nkunku. 

   Armando Broja isn’t far away from returning and testing Nicolas Jackson. 

   Pochettino confirmed Reece James is eyeing a return before the next international break, which sparks a pinch of positivity. “He’s recovering well. He is starting to do things on the pitch with the ball. He’s really well. He’s desperate to return and help the team. I hope he’s close and hope he can be available before the next international break,” said Pochettino, when asked about the Chelsea skipper’s return date.

   And finally, Carney Chukwuemeka, Marcus Bettinelli and Wesley Fofana complete the injury list.

Predicted XI

AFC Bournemouth probable line-up (4-2-3-1): Neto; Aarons, Zabarnyi, Senesi, Kerkez; Christie, Cook; Brooks, Billing, Tavernier; Solanke

Chelsea probable line-up (3-5-2): Sanchez; Disasi, Thiago Silva, Colwill; Gusto, Caicedo, Enzo, Gallagher, Chilwell; Sterling, Jackson

Match Prediction

   Both defenses tend to concede, and we can expect Bournemouth to crack Chelsea’s back line open. But Raheem Sterling’s form, combined with Jackson’s threat on goal could prove too much for the Cherries.

Predicted score: AFC Bournemouth 1-2 Chelsea
